Posted December 13, 2012 SLATE SLAB:3kg Concrete (1.5kg Lye + 1.5kg Mortar) --- (Concrete chance was low with my stats)+Slate Shingle (Made from Chisel on Slate Shard)This CREATES (was 99%) My Mason is only 43ql, Alchemy 6, Natural Substances 14 (Add Epic Skills Adjustment Im on Elevation)THEN:[23:31:18] <Karellean> [23:30:54] You see a slate slab under construction. Ql: 3.1966944, Dam: 0.0. The slate slab needs 4 concrete, and 20 slate shingle to be finished.Your all welcome...(Ouch by the way on mats)This means 7.5 Ash, (and 15kg water) + 15kg Sand + 15kg Clay +21 Slate Shards for one Slate Slab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
Posted December 13, 2012 (edited) Due to weight of Slab (15kg Shingles x 20) Most of you will need to finish this on the ground...Fear not... The Slab reverts to 80kg once completeAnd in continuation of this:Also I just happen to have Paving 30 Due to the Image Below.....[23:54:44] You plan a opening made of slate slab.[23:54:54] You see a opening under construction. The opening requires 2 slate slabs and 10 mortar to be finished.SO for a slate slab floor22.5 Ash , 45kg of water 55kg of Sand, 55kg Clay + 63 Slate Shards...Enjoy...
